Denison sweeps 3-game set with Calvin

Box Score 1 | Box Score 2

The Denison baseball team opened the 2016 campaign by capping off a three-game series sweep of Calvin on Saturday at Grand Park in Westfield, Ind. The Big Red took both games of Saturday's doubleheader, winning game one 10-3 before taking the finale 18-11. The season-opening sweep marks DU's first 3-0 start since the 2004 squad opened the year with four-consecutive wins.

In the opener, the Big Red rallied from an early 3-1 deficit by scoring nine unanswered runs over the final five innings. A two-run triple by junior Eric Zmuda tied the game at 3-3 in the fifth. Senior Jake Meegan and sophomore Sam Frazen both touched the dish on Zmuda's extra-base hit. The junior came around to score the game-winning run on a base hit to center by sophomore Jack Blanchard. Senior Joe LaPlaca knocked in Evan Flax and Noah Hahn with a base hit up the middle in the sixth. The senior also scored in the inning on a wild pitch. The DU offense added a single run in each of the final three frames. Blachard scored on an RBI ground out in the seventh, while Meegan crossed the plate on a wild pitch in the eighth. Meegan also drove in the final run of the game in the ninth on a sac fly to left that plated Ethan Carlyon.

Offensively, Denison pounded out 13 hits and had eight different player record a hit. Of those eight players, four registered multiple hits. Meegan went 3-for-4 at the place with an RBI and three runs scored, while Blanchard, Hahn and Flax all collected two hits and scored once. Blanchard also drove in a pair, while Flax knocked in another. LaPlaca also had two RBIs and a run.

Senior starter Ian Walsh picked up the win after surrendering three runs on seven hits with five strikeouts in five innings of work. Freshman reliever Mikey Rivera tossed four shutout inning, scattering two hits and striking out three en route to earning the four-inning save.

In the nightcap, the two teams tossed the lead back-and-forth over the first five innings. Trailing 9-7 heading into the eighth, the Big Red erupted for six runs on six hits to take a four-run lead. DU sent 10 men to the plate in the inning. Junior Phil Papaioannou cut the deficit to one with an RBI double down the left line that scored pinch runner LaPlaca from second. Blanchard tied the game once again with a base hit to center that scored Papaioannou. Hahn gave Denison its final lead with a ground ball to short that score Meegan. A two-run single by Joseph Maydwell and an RBI triple by Brandon Morgan capped off the eighth-inning scoring.

The Big Red put the game out of reach with a five-run ninth. Hahn provided an RBI single, while Flax legged out a two-run triple to center. Maydwell delivered the final blow with an RBI single that scored Flax. The sophomore was able to slide home safely on the play thanks to a three-base miscue in right.

Zmuda, Blanchard, Flax and Maydwell all posted three hits in the game. Zmuda tied the single-game school record for runs scored with five. Maydwell drove in five runs and scored two more, while Flax finished with four RBIs. Blanchard knocked in three and touched the plate three times. Hahn and Papaioannou each had two runs and two RBIs. Andrew Bruss picked up the win in relief after allowing two unearned runs on three hits with two strikeouts in three innings of work.

Denison improves to 3-0 after winning Friday's season opener (3-2) in 11 innings and sweeping Saturday's doubleheader, while Calvin falls to 0-3 on the year. The Big Red returns to action March 13 when they kick off their spring trip in Belton, Texas at Mary Hardin-Baylor.
